N-Heptane is the preferred hydrocarbon with n-pentane still being used, although hexane is used on occasion (Speight, 2007, and references cited therein). Although n-pentane and n-heptane are the solvents of choice in the laboratory, other solvents are also used (Mitchell and Speight, 1973; Speight, 1979). These solvents separate the asphaltene fraction as a brown-to-black powdery material. , liquid propane, liquid butane, or mixtures of both) are the solvents of choice and the product is a semisolid (tacky) to solid asphalt.
